Importazione di un file CSV

Le informazioni che si trovano in un file CSV possono soltanto essere importate.

Selezionare File | Importa | CSV per importare le informazioni da un file CSV.

Ogni riga del file CSV rappresenta un elemento e un comando di un elemento che PC-DMIS crea durante l'importazione. Se sono specificati i valori delle tolleranze, viene aggiunto anche un comando delle dimensioni della posizione.

La prima riga del file CSV contiene gli indicatori dei formati. Questa riga di indicatori indica i dati di ciascuna colonna. Le intestazioni delle colonne sono predefinite. Le colonne che non hanno indicatore di formato o un'intestazione non riconosciuta sono ignorate. Le colonne possono essere in qualsiasi ordine. Se la colonna "Tipo" manca o in una riga di dati non è specificato il tipo dell'elemento, PC-DMIS considera la riga di informazioni come relativa a un elemento “Punto”.

Se una riga ha solo un asterisco nella colonna 1 senza altre informazioni, significa che la prossima riga sarà ancora una riga di indicatori di formati. Questo permette all'utente di passare da un formato all'altro all'interno di un singolo file CSV.

Formato file...

Un file CSV è un file di valori separati da virgole che può essere creato da diversi pacchetti software, tra cui Microsoft Excel. Ecco un esempio di una tabella Excel usata per creare un file CSV:

Primo esempio di una tabella del foglio di calcolo usata per creare un file CSV

Continuazione della tabella del foglio di calcolo di esempio utilizzata sopra per creare un file CSV

Scaricare qui l'esempio di il file CSV: CSV_Example_File.csv

Un altro esempio di tabella su un foglio di calcolo usata per creare un file CSV è mostrato nell'immagine seguente.

TIPO NOME X Y Z +TOL -TOL
Punto X48a001 68 90 14 0,05 0,05
Punto X48a002 74 85 12 0,05  
Punto X48a006 76 84 11    
Punto X48a011 79 83,5 10,75 0,035 0,035
Punto X48a021 85 83,25 10,67 0,035 0,035
Punto X48a022 88 2,375 10,5 0,035 0,035
Punto X48a029 97 82,125 10,375 0,05 0,05

Secondo esempio di una tabella su un foglio di calcolo usata per creare un file CSV

La prima riga (TIPO, NOME, X, Y, Z, TOL+, TOL-) è la riga di designazione del formato.

Si noti che nel secondo esempio la riga due è un elemento Punto, e specifica sia +TOL sia -TOL. Un comando di elemento Punto e un comando di dimensioni di posizione sono aggiunti in base alle informazioni su questa riga.

Per l'elemento Punto della riga quattro non sono specificate né la tolleranza positiva né quella negativa. Sarà aggiunto solo un comando di elemento. Non verrà aggiunto un comando di dimensioni della posizione.

Indicatori dei formati

La prima linea (o riga se si visualizza il file in Excel) di un file CSV, è la linea di indicazione del formato. Indica il tipo di dati contenuti nelle righe successive. Il seguente è un elenco degli indicatori dei formati validi ammessi quando si importa un file CSV.

TIPO – È il tipo di elemento. Le voci ammesse per questa colonna sono: Punto, Linea, Piano, Cerchio, Ellisse, Asola rotonda, Asola quadrata, Asola aperta, Poligono, Cilindro, Cono e Sfera.

NOME – è il nome dell'elemento

X – Valore nominale X dell'elemento

Y – Valore nominale Y dell'elemento

Z – Valore nominale Z dell'elemento

X2Secondo valore nominale Xdell'elemento

Y2Secondo valore nominale Ydell'elemento

Z2Secondo valore nominale Zdell'elemento

DDiametro nominale dell'elemento

AAngolo nominale dell'elemento in gradi

LLunghezza nominale dell'elemento

WLarghezza nominale dell'elemento

i – Vettore nominale i dell'elemento

j – Vettore nominale j dell'elemento

k – Vettore nominale k dell'elemento

i2Secondo vettore nominale i dell'elemento

j2Secondo vettore nominale j dell'elemento

k2Secondo vettore nominale k dell'elemento

+TOLTolleranza positiva dell'elemento

-TOLTolleranza negativa dell'elemento

Carattere asterisco (*) per gli indicatori di più formati

Un carattere asterisco (*) nella prima posizione in una riga di dati delimitati da virgole indica che questa è l'ultima roga dei dati oggetto dell'indicatore del formato. Indica anche che la riga successiva è una riga con un nuovo indicatore del formato. Questo permette di avere elementi di diverso tipo in un file CSV con righe più semplici di indicatori dei formati:

Il carattere * nella riga 4 indica a qui PC-DMIS di usare il nuovo indicatore del formato nella riga 5 per due elementi Cerchio

Sequenza di importazione dei file

Di seguito è descritta la sequenza di eventi che si verificano quando si importa un file CSV.

  1. Ogni riga di dati è letta in PC-DMIS dal file CSV.

  2. Le informazioni vengono confrontate con le intestazioni delle colonne definite in precedenza per determinare il significato di ogni elemento di informazione.

  3. In base al tipo di elemento, PC-DMIS usa le informazioni per creare il comando di un elemento.

  4. Se sono specificati i valori di una o di entrambe tolleranze, PC-DMIS aggiunge anche un comando delle dimensioni della posizione.